A group of people in India was walking home after visiting a holy city.

They were part of a special religious walk called the Kanwar Yatra.

A music truck was playing loud songs at the front of the group.

Suddenly, the truck touched a big electric wire that was hanging low.

The electricity from the wire shocked five people who were riding on top of the truck.

Some people quickly jumped off the truck to keep themselves safe.

Everyone in the procession got scared and worried.

The injured people were taken to a hospital in a town called Tijara.

Later, they were moved to another city called Alwar for more treatment.

One of the injured teenagers was in a serious condition.

Key facts

Location
Jojaka village, Khairthal-Tijara district, Rajasthan
Cause
Contact with low-hanging 11-kV power line
Number Injured
5 people
Identified Injured
Mohit (15), Sunil (14), Sagar (11), Taran (15)
Treatment
Hospital in Tijara; referred to Alwar
Serious Condition
Sunil
Context
Kanwar Yatra return from Haridwar with Gangajal
Additional Injury
Another Kanwariya suffered burn injuries
